This is the cabinet (amiibo) applet. See AM_services#Library_Applets.
Library Applet Versions
| System Version | Value |
|---|---|
| [1.0.0+] | 0x1 |

ReturnValueForAmiiboSettings
This is "nn::nfp::ReturnValueForAmiiboSettings". This struct is 0x188-bytes.
| Offset | Size | Description |
|---|---|---|
| 0x0 | 0x1 | Flags. 0 = error, non-zero = success. |
| 0x1 | 0x3 | Padding |
| 0x4 | 0x8 | nn::nfp::DeviceHandle |
| 0xC | 0x58 | |
| 0x64 | 0x100 | nn::nfp::RegisterInfo, only available when flags bit2 is set. |
| 0x164 | 0x24 |
Usage
User-processes should push a common arguments struct as well as the #StartParamForAmiiboSettings struct. Once the applet finishes running successfully, it will return an output storage containing a #ReturnValueForAmiiboSettings. sdknso doesn't validate the storage size, an error is thrown if #ReturnValueForAmiiboSettings+0x0 is 0.
